Some of Princess Margaret (Vanessa Kirkby)’s costumes from Philip Martin and Stephen Daldry’s ‘The Crown’ (2016), designed by Michele Clapton and Timothy Everest.Clapton said about designing Margaret’s costumes: ‘For her costumes, I wanted to look at the movement outside of the royal family – what was really going on. We also hand painted and beaded this lovely mink coloured dress for a scene when she gives a speech at the American embassy, and I just thought, “I’m going to put great big pockets in it.” I loved the idea of her having pockets in this evening dress so that she could swagger around, and Vanessa loved that too. One shirt I really wanted to do was in a Brutalist print, a nod to her later dabble in the arts. With Margaret, everything was just a little better cut – the coats were a bit longer, there was just a bit more thought about it. I enjoyed playing the two sisters against each other.’(Full interview here) -- source link
